New insights into properties of the ground waters of Northern Switzerland

Since 1981, Nagra has conducted extensive regional studies into the hydrophysical and hydrochemical properties of deep groundwaters from northern Switzerland and adjacent areas. The understanding of the groundwaters in the Triassic and Permian aquifers as well as in the crystalline basement has been considerably enhanced by the deep drilling program of Nagra. This paper presents selected results of the investigations and discusses them with respect to deep groundwater flow systems in northern Switzerland. The composition of dissolved gases present in the groundwaters is very characteristic for each of the different aquifers. Oxygen is almost invariably absent and nitrogen is often the dominant gas. High nitrogen-argon-ratios, as typical of the Permian and Lower Triassic aquifers indicate that a part of the nitrogen is released from organic compounds. In the vicinity of the Rhine graben, ascending carbon dioxide results in a high concentration of this gas in the deep groundwaters of the crystalline basement. Radiogenic-produced helium is enriched in these waters due to the long subsurface retention times. South of the Jura mountains, high concentrations of hydrogen sulphide in waters of the Upper Muschelkalk aquifer are related to the occurrence of hydrocarbons. The Malm, Upper Muschelkalk and Permian-Lower Triassic aquifers and locally that of the crystalline basement are all separated by hydraulic barriers as demonstrated, for example, by the Weiach borehole. Waters of each of the different aquifers can be clearly distinguished from their hydrogeochemistry. The NaCl-character of the Malm aquifer water is attributed to marine formation waters that descended from the overlying Molasse sediments. Comparatively low mineralisation in the waters of the Upper Muschelkalk suggests that there is a significantly high flow rate in this aquifer. 3 refs., 3 figs., 5 tabs
